Sourcefire expands in Eastern Europe
2009-10-22
In one announcement, IPS vendor SourceFire has unveiled an important extension of its distribution network in Eastern and Northern Europe. The company has signed distribution partnerships with VADs Real Security in Slovenia, World IT Systems in Poland, Provision in Romania, Computerlinks in Finland and the Baltic countries (Estonia, Latvia and Lithuania) and Israeli Multipoint for whole Middle East (albeit it is quite difficult to address Muslim countries from an Israeli-based company).

World IT goes east
2008-12-24
Russia : Polish VAD World IT Systems has opened its first subsidiary abroad, in Moscow. Managed by Jean-Paul Bergmans, former Sun manager in Russia, its goal is to work closer with Russian system integrators (source : Computer Reseller News Rossiya).
